Microneedling, also known as collagen induction therapy, involves the use of fine needles to create microscopic channels in the skin. These tiny wounds stimulate the body's natural healing process, promoting collagen and elastin production, which are crucial for skin repair and rejuvenation. The process can improve skin texture, reduce the appearance of scars, and enhance overall skin health.
Red light therapy, on the other hand, utilizes low-level wavelengths of red light to penetrate the skin. This therapy is known for its ability to enhance cellular energy, reduce inflammation, and accelerate the healing process. When used post-microneedling, red light therapy can further boost the skin's receptivity to healing by promoting cellular regeneration and reducing any potential inflammation or redness.
The Synergy of Microneedling and Red Light Therapy
The combination of these two treatments in Duncan can be particularly powerful. The micro-injuries created by microneedling make the skin more receptive to the beneficial effects of red light therapy. This dual approach can lead to more effective and quicker results, as the red light can penetrate deeper into the newly stimulated skin layers.
However, it is crucial to follow a proper protocol to ensure safety and maximize benefits. Immediately after microneedling, the skin is in a heightened state of sensitivity. Applying red light therapy too soon might cause discomfort or irritation. Typically, a waiting period of 24 to 48 hours is recommended to allow the skin to begin its natural healing process before introducing red light therapy.
